View Single Post #4 01-25-2007, 04:49 PM Yoda Administrator Join Date: Jan 2005 Location: Atlanta, Georgia Posts: 10,681 Ball Location For the Driver Originally Posted by strav Where do you recommend the ball should be positioned for the Driver? With the Driver, you usually should locate the Ball just inside the Left Shoulder, i.e., just Up Plane from Low Point. This will permit a very slight descending blow and insure adequate Backspin for directional control. However, if maximum distance is the goal, then a low-spin 'tumbler' is in order, and this requires an Upstroke Impact. In turn, this requires that the Ball be located ahead of the Left Shoulder at Address (assuming the player does not artificially alter the Shoulder's location during the Stroke and prior to Impact). __________________ Yoda Yoda View Public Profile Send a private message to Yoda Visit Yoda's homepage!
